Key Takeaways: Drone Warfare in Action
- Hunter-Killer Precision: Ukrainian forces are increasingly using hunter-killer drone tactics. This involves using one drone to spot enemy positions and then directing a second, weaponized drone to carry out the attack, as seen in footage of motorcycle-mounted Russian troops being targeted. This coordinated approach minimizes risk to Ukrainian personnel while maximizing the impact of drone strikes.
- Disrupting Supply Lines: Drones arenβt just targeting frontline troops. Footage reveals how theyβre disrupting Russian supply lines by destroying vehicles like the Bukhanka and UAZ-452 vans, hindering the movement of ammunition, reinforcements, and other essential supplies.
- Artillery Duel from Above: Ukrainian artillery units are using drone reconnaissance to pinpoint hidden Russian artillery positions, enabling precise counter-battery fire. This reduces the effectiveness of Russian artillery support and demonstrates the growing sophistication of Ukrainian targeting capabilities.
- FPV Kamikaze Drones: First-person view (FPV) kamikaze drones are playing a significant role, offering a low-cost, high-impact method for destroying enemy strongholds and vehicles. Videos highlight the effectiveness of these drones in targeting Russian BMP-3s, 2S1 Gvozdikas, and Ural-4320 trucks.
- Unpredictable Enemy Behavior: Footage reveals instances of Russian troops exhibiting unpredictable behavior in response to drone presence, sometimes taking ineffective cover or making tactical errors. This highlights the psychological impact of drone warfare and the challenges faced by forces adapting to this new threat.
The Evolving Battlefield: Trends and Predictions
The videos analyzed reveal several key trends in drone warfare: increased reliance on networked drone operations, the growing importance of electronic warfare countermeasures, and the blurring lines between conventional and unconventional warfare. As drone technology continues to advance, we can expect to see even more sophisticated tactics emerge, including swarming attacks, autonomous drone operations, and the integration of artificial intelligence for target identification and engagement.
